• Why is air pollution a major issue in Mexico City?

• -Sierra Madre Mountains block the pollution from leaving the Plateau of Mexico.

• Overpopulation and industrialization have increased the amount of pollution produced.

• The wind patterns are not strong enough to push the pollution away from Mexico City.
